Few recent combine stars have become productive NFL players

By Mike Sando
ESPN.com

Wednesday, February 20, 2008

NFL hopefuls routinely bolster their draft status through feats of speed, strength and agility. In recent seasons, cornerbacks Dunta Robinson and Carlos Rogers strengthened their standing as top-10 draft choices by impressing teams at the annual scouting combine. Since 2000, Terence Newman, Vernon Davis, LaRon Landry, Troy Williamson, Haloti Ngata, Brodrick Bunkley and Tye Hill were also among those who tested well enough in specific areas to help secure spots early in their draft classes. ...
